li xin shi ya qi ji hou wan ye lun shi yan yan jiu ( yi )
Diao Zhenggang Chen Jingyi Cao Xiaojin Yu Yuanyan Wang Entao Pang Mingzhu Tests of an impeller with 25° backswept were conducted to establish stage and impeller characteristics. Tip speed of 380 m/sec was attained. Comparing with a radial discharge impeller which has the same diameter and inducer blade profile;stage efficiency was increased by 4 percent;and operating range was improved significantly. The effect of reaction on stage performance is analysed. Test data of slip facter and energy transfer coefficient are given.
